During the night, heavy rain fell all along the coast, in the center of the country and in the northern mountains.
The rain that began to fall yesterday evening will continue this morning (Friday), accompanied by thunderstorms, mainly in the north and center of the country.
Local rain is expected in the Negev.
Strong winds will blow and there is a fear of flooding in the coastal plain.
There is a fear of floods in the streams of the Dead Sea and in the Judean desert.
There will be a drop in temperatures, which will be lower than normal for the season.
Western winds will blow along the coast and the sea will be very rough.
The height of the waves is between 260 and 320 cm.
Local rain will continue to fall in the north of the country and in the center tomorrow. Until noon there is still a fear of floods in the Judean Desert and the Dead Sea area. During the day the rain will gradually weaken. There will be a slight increase in temperatures, which will continue to be lower than normal for the season. Sunday will be partly cloudy to cloudy, with another slight increase in temperatures. Monday will be partly cloudy, and temperatures will return to normal for the season.
